Step 1. Remove the thermostat battery cover, located in front at the bottom of your thermostat. See the part I highlighted in the image below: Step 2: Gently squeeze and pull down the bottom sides of the battery cover to remove it. You will see a couple of two AA batteries. Locate the reset button (small hole) on the right of the battery ...Honeywell thermostats are among the most popular models available, and resetting them is fairly simple. In order to perform a factory reset on a T6 thermostat: Press and hold the button until the Advanced menu opens. You should see "ADV" at the top of the screen of the thermostat. If "MENU" is displayed, go back and redo step 1 until "ADV" appears at the top. Scroll to "ADV RESET" using or arrows, then press.You can reset a Honeywell thermostat by using the Honeywell digital thermostat's reset button. To clear the schedule on your Honeywell 4000 series thermostat: Press the 'Set' button until the display shows 'Set Schedule.'. Select the mode you want to clear the schedules for, choose either Heat or Cool. Press and hold the up arrow key and the 'Hold' button simultaneously for four seconds to clear a schedule.This video covers how to reset the WiFi connection on the Lyric Round Smart Thermostat through the Honeywell Home app on an Android device!http://bit.ly/2llGsuIstuck thermostat fix reset reprogram (honeywell rth2510 / rth2410 series)Each model of the Honeywell thermostat has a different reset mechanism. A: There are three main types of resets for Honeywell thermostats: factory reset, WiFi reset, and schedule reset.The Honeywell 8000 series is a programmable thermostat with a touchscreen interface. Here is how to reset these models: Tap the ‘System’ button. Press and hold the center blank box at the bottom of the screen. Change the number on the left-hand side of the screen to ‘0710’ and on the right-hand side to ‘1’. Press ‘Done’.Locate the Reset Button: Find the reset button on your Honeywell Pro Series thermostat.
